Flash 脚本语言入门指南268


引言

Flash 脚本语言是一种基于 ActionScript 的编程语言,用于创建交互式 Flash 内容。它允许开发人员向 Flash 动画、游戏和网站添加逻辑、动态和交互性。本文将提供 Flash 脚本语言的入门指南,重点介绍其基本语法、数据类型、控制流和事件处理。

1. 基本语法

Flash 脚本语言的语法类似于 JavaScript。它使用分号 (;) 作为语句结束符,使用花括号 ({ }) 来括住代码块。注释使用双反斜杠 (//) 或多行注释符号 (/* */)。

2. 数据类型

Flash 脚本语言支持各种数据类型,包括:

- Boolean:真或假

- Number:数字

- String:字符串

- Array:数组

- Object:对象

3. 控制流

Flash 脚本语言提供了用于控制程序流的各种结构,包括:

- 条件语句 (if/else):根据条件执行代码。

- 循环语句 (for/while/do-while):重复执行代码。

- 异常处理 (try/catch):处理运行时错误。

4. 事件处理

Flash 脚本语言允许开发人员对用户交互和事件做出响应,例如单击、鼠标移动和键盘输入。通过使用侦听器,开发人员可以定义当事件发生时执行的代码块。

5. 变量

变量用于存储数据并可在程序中访问。它们使用 var 关键字声明,后面是变量名。变量可以保存任何数据类型。

6. 函数

函数是可重用的代码块,用于执行特定任务。它们使用 function 关键字声明,后面是函数名和参数列表。函数还返回一个值。

7. 对象

对象是用于存储相关数据和方法的容器。它们使用 var 关键字将其声明为对象类型,然后使用点运算符访问其属性和方法。

8. 类

类是用于定义对象蓝图的模板。它们使用 class 关键字声明,后面是类名和属性和方法列表。

9. Flash IDE 和代码编辑器

Flash 脚本语言通常在 Adobe Flash IDE 或第三方代码编辑器中编写。IDE 提供了用于创建和编辑 Flash 内容的综合环境,而代码编辑器提供了更高级的文本编辑功能。

10. 调试

调试对于识别和修复 Flash 脚本语言中的错误至关重要。Flash IDE 和代码编辑器提供了调试工具,例如断点、堆栈跟踪和控制台输出。

结论

Flash 脚本语言是一种强大的编程语言,用于创建动态和交互式 Flash 内容。通过掌握其基本语法、数据类型、控制流和事件处理,开发人员可以创建高度交互式动画、游戏和网站。

2025-01-07


上一篇:动态类型脚本语言:理解其优点和局限性

下一篇:Flash 脚本语言大全:深入探索 ActionScript 和 Haxe